Pyramica (Smithistruma) behasyla (Bolton)

Pyramica (Smithistruma) behasyla (Bolton)

return to key {link to the Hymenoptera Name Server} Type location Cameroun (Smithistruma behasyla sp. n., Bolton, 1983: 286, illustrated, full-face view, worker), collected near Yaoundé by G. Terron; holotype worker and one paratype worker - see below .


{Pyramica (Smithistruma) behasyla}Bolton's description (1983) is at {original description}.

WORKER - TL 2.5 mm; distinguished by having two transverse bands of scale-like to suborbicular hairs on dorsum of head; colour light brown .
